From: Interleukin 13 promotes long-term recovery after ischemic stroke by inhibiting the activation of STAT3

Fig. 4

IL-13 reduces OL/OPC death after exposure to OGD/R and encourages OPC differentiation in a microglia-dependent manner. (A) OL/OPC survival after OGD/R was quantified by live/dead staining. Aa Representative images of live (green) and dead (red) staining of cultured oligodendrocytes or OPCs. Scale bar: 25 μm. Ab Percentages of dead cells were quantified. Data are from 4 independent experiments. B–D NG2 and MBP immunostaining was performed to evaluate OPC differentiation. B Primary OPC cultures were treated with T3 (100 ng/mL) + CNTF (20 ng/mL) or escalating concentrations of IL-13 for 3 days. Ba Cells were triple-stained with MBP (red), NG2 (green), and DAPI (blue). Scale bar: 25 μm. Bb Quantification of MBP+ OLs and NG2+ OPCs after treated with escalating concentrations of IL-13. Data are from 4 independent experiments. Bc Quantification of OPCs survival after treated with escalating concentrations of IL-13. n = 5/group. C Typical OPC and OL were selected for reconstruction of 3D-rendered images. D Primary OPCs were co-cultured with microglia treated with/without IL-13 (20 ng/ml) for 3 days. Da Cells were then immunostained for MBP (red) and NG2 (green), and nuclei were labeled with DAPI (blue). After skeleton reconstruction, the protrusion length and the number of protrusions of each cell were analyzed. White rectangles illustrates: where skeleton images were taken from. The red reconstruction line in the skeleton images show the longest path of each cell. Scale bar: 25 μm. Db Quantification of MBP+ OLs. Data are from 4 independent experiments. Dc–e Quantification of the number, the maximum protrusion length and the longest path of each cell. Each point shown in the results represents a cell. Four independent experimental samples were analyzed in each group, and a total of n = 40 cells were analyzed in each group. All data are presented as the mean ± SEM. *p ≤ 0.05, **p ≤ 0.01, ***p ≤ 0.001. One-way ANOVA followed by Bonferroni’s post hoc, or Kruskal–Wallis test followed by Dunn’s post hoc
